What Exactly is an Engine Oil Additive to Clean Engine?

An engine oil additive designed for cleaning is a specialized chemical formulation added to your engine’s crankcase, typically before an oil change. Its primary purpose is to break down and remove harmful deposits that accumulate inside your engine. These deposits include sludge, varnish, and carbon buildup.

Think of it as a deep-cleaning agent for the internal components of your engine. These additives are formulated to be compatible with various engine types and oil formulations, working safely to loosen stubborn grime. They circulate with your existing engine oil, targeting areas where deposits tend to form.

Understanding Sludge and Varnish

Sludge and varnish are the arch-enemies of a clean-running engine. Sludge is a thick, tar-like substance that forms when oil degrades due to heat, oxidation, and contamination. It can block oil passages, restrict lubrication, and lead to premature wear.

Varnish, on the other hand, is a thinner, lacquer-like film that coats engine parts. While not as thick as sludge, it can still interfere with the smooth operation of components like piston rings and valve lifters. Both reduce efficiency and increase friction.

How These Additives Work Their Magic

Engine cleaning additives typically contain powerful detergents and dispersants. Detergents work to dissolve existing sludge and varnish from metal surfaces. Dispersants then hold these contaminants in suspension within the oil.

This prevents the loosened deposits from clumping together and causing new blockages. When you drain the old oil, these suspended contaminants are carried out with it, leaving your engine cleaner. The process is designed to be gentle yet effective, ensuring no harm to vital engine components.

Restored Performance and Fuel Economy

When sludge and varnish build up, they impede the smooth operation of internal engine parts. Piston rings can stick, valves may not seat properly, and hydraulic lifters can become noisy. Removing these deposits allows components to move freely as designed.

This restoration of proper function can lead to improved compression, smoother idle, and better throttle response. Many users also report a noticeable increase in fuel economy as the engine operates more efficiently. It’s like giving your engine a fresh breath of air.

Extended Engine Life

A clean engine is a happy engine, and a happy engine lasts longer. By preventing blockages in oil passages, additives ensure that lubricating oil reaches all critical components effectively. This reduces friction and wear, which are major contributors to engine degradation.

Regular use of an engine oil additive to clean engine as part of your maintenance routine can significantly extend the lifespan of your engine. This is particularly crucial for older vehicles or those with high mileage, helping them run reliably for years to come.

Step-by-Step Application for DIYers

  1. Gather Your Supplies: You’ll need the engine oil additive, new engine oil, a new oil filter, a drain pan, a funnel, a wrench for the drain plug, and an oil filter wrench. Safety glasses and gloves are also recommended.
  2. Warm Up the Engine: Drive your vehicle for about 10-15 minutes to bring the engine oil to operating temperature. Warm oil flows better and allows the additive to mix and circulate more effectively.
  3. Add the Cleaner: Park your vehicle on a level surface. With the engine off, open the oil filler cap. Carefully pour the recommended amount of engine oil additive directly into the engine’s oil filler neck.
  4. Run the Engine: Replace the oil filler cap. Start the engine and let it idle for the duration specified by the additive manufacturer (typically 10-20 minutes). Do NOT drive the vehicle during this time unless the product explicitly states otherwise.
  5. Drain the Oil: After the recommended running time, turn off the engine. Place your drain pan under the oil pan. Remove the drain plug and allow the old oil, now laden with suspended contaminants, to drain completely.
  6. Replace Filter and Refill: Install a new oil filter and replace the drain plug. Fill the engine with the manufacturer-recommended fresh engine oil. Check the oil level with the dipstick, ensuring it’s within the proper range.
  7. Dispose of Old Oil: Properly dispose of the used oil and filter at a certified recycling center. Never pour used oil down the drain or into the ground.

Important Safety Precautions

Always work in a well-ventilated area to avoid inhaling fumes. Wear appropriate personal protective equipment, including safety glasses and gloves, to protect against splashes and skin contact. Engine oil and additives can be irritants.

Ensure the vehicle is securely parked and the engine is off before working on it, except when running the additive as instructed. Allow hot engine components to cool slightly before touching them. If you’re unsure about any step, consult a professional mechanic. Safety is paramount.

The Myth of the “Miracle Cure”

An engine oil additive can clean existing deposits, but it cannot repair mechanical damage or wear caused by prolonged neglect. If your engine is already suffering from severe issues like worn bearings or cracked seals, an additive won’t fix those problems.

It’s a maintenance tool, not a repair solution. Manage your expectations; while it can restore performance lost due to buildup, it won’t turn an ailing engine into a brand-new one. Regular maintenance remains the cornerstone of engine health.

Potential Risks and How to Avoid Them

One potential risk is using an additive in an extremely dirty engine where massive amounts of sludge could be dislodged too quickly. This can lead to chunks of sludge blocking oil pickup screens or narrow oil passages, potentially starving the engine of lubrication. This is a common problem with engine oil additive to clean engine in severely neglected vehicles.

To avoid this, for very dirty engines, consider a milder cleaner or a shorter treatment time, followed by an immediate oil change. Never leave the cleaning additive in your engine for extended periods, as it’s designed to be drained with the old oil. Always follow the instructions precisely to mitigate risks.

Beyond the Bottle: Regular Maintenance is Key

No additive can compensate for neglected basic maintenance. Regular oil changes with high-quality oil are the single most important factor in preventing sludge and varnish buildup. Always use the oil viscosity and type recommended by your vehicle manufacturer.

Ensure you’re changing your oil and filter according to your owner’s manual, or more frequently if you engage in severe driving conditions like heavy towing, extreme temperatures, or frequent off-roading. A clean air filter and proper engine operating temperature also contribute to overall engine cleanliness. These proactive steps reduce the need for aggressive cleaning.

Listening to Your Engine

Your engine often communicates its needs through sounds and performance changes. Pay attention to any new noises, such as ticking lifters, or a noticeable drop in power or fuel efficiency. These can be early warning signs of internal deposit buildup.

Addressing these symptoms promptly, possibly with a targeted cleaning additive, can prevent minor issues from escalating into major problems. Regular visual inspections of your oil (checking for excessive darkness or gritty texture) can also provide clues about your engine’s internal condition.

Frequently Asked Questions About Engine Oil Additives

Can an engine oil additive damage my engine?

Reputable, high-quality engine oil additives designed for cleaning are generally safe when used according to their instructions. However, using unknown brands, harsh solvent-based products, or leaving the additive in for too long can potentially damage seals or dislodge large chunks of sludge that cause blockages. Always stick to trusted brands and follow directions carefully.

How often should I use an engine cleaning additive?

Most manufacturers recommend using an engine cleaning additive every 15,000 to 30,000 miles, or before every few oil changes. If your vehicle has high mileage, a history of infrequent oil changes, or you drive in severe conditions, you might consider more frequent use, but always pair it with an immediate oil and filter change.

Are engine cleaning additives necessary with synthetic oil?

While synthetic oils are far superior at resisting sludge and varnish formation compared to conventional oils, deposits can still accumulate over time, especially in older engines or those with extended drain intervals. Using an additive periodically can still be beneficial to maintain optimal internal cleanliness, even with synthetic oil.

Will an engine oil additive fix a noisy lifter?

A noisy lifter, often caused by varnish or sludge blocking the small oil passages within the lifter, can sometimes be quieted by an engine cleaning additive. The additive helps dissolve these deposits, allowing oil to flow properly and the lifter to function correctly. However, if the lifter is mechanically worn, an additive will not fix it, and professional repair will be needed.

Can I mix different brands of engine oil additives?

It is generally not recommended to mix different brands or types of engine oil additives. Each product has a specific chemical formulation designed to work independently. Mixing them could lead to unintended chemical reactions, reduced effectiveness, or even potential harm to your engine. Stick to one product at a time and follow its specific usage instructions.
